It's no secret that I love fall. I love fall fashion, fall activities, seasonal food, pumpkin spice coffee and even the weather. But once Halloween passes and the temperature drops below 60, I find myself being affected by seasonal depression. During the fall and winter, I struggle a lot mentally. I have an extremely hard time getting out of bed, staying motivated, socializing...and my energy is at an all-time low.

In today's episode, I explain what seasonal depression is, my experience with it, how to improve your mental health during the fall and winter as well as some products to buy that can help combat seasonal depression.
